This document replaces GB/T 11354-2005 "Determination of nitriding layer depth and metallographic examination of steel parts" and GB/T 11354- Compared with.2005, in addition to structural adjustments and editorial changes, the main technical changes are as follows. a) The scope has been changed (see Chapter 1, Chapter 1 of the.2005 edition); b) Added the terms and definitions of “nitriding hardened layer depth” and “compound layer thickness” (see 3.1 and 3.2); c) Added symbols and abbreviations (see Chapter 4); d) Added the determination principle of hardened layer depth and the provisions of test equipment (see 5.1.1 and 5.1.2); e) The provisions on specimens, test methods and results have been modified (see 5.1.3, 5.1.4, 5.1.5, Chapter 5 and 6.1 of the.2005 edition); f) Deleted the provisions on measurement steps and results, metallographic method and arbitration (see 6.2, 6.3 and 6.4 of the.2005 edition); g) Added the method for determining the thickness of the compound layer (see 5.2); h) The original description of tissue levels was changed, and "fine needle-shaped trochophores" were deleted [see Figures 6a) to 6e, Table 1 of the.2005 edition]; i) Deleted the important parts in the metallographic inspection regarding the original structure, nitriding layer brittleness, nitriding layer looseness, and nitride grade assessment (See 4.2, 7.4, 8.2, and 9.2 of the.2005 edition); j) The requirement to repeat the measurement of nitrided layer brittleness once has been deleted (see 7.3 of the.2005 edition); k) The content of the test report has been changed (see Chapter 7, Chapter 10 of the.2005 edition); l) Added the interpolation method for determining the depth of nitriding hardened layer (see Appendix A). Determination of nitriding layer depth and metallographic structure inspection of steel parts

1 Scope

This document specifies the method for determining the depth of nitriding and nitrocarburizing layers on steel parts and the method for examining the metallographic structure before and after nitriding. This document is applicable to the measurement of nitriding hardening layer depth and compound layer thickness after gas nitriding, ion nitriding and nitrocarburizing of steel parts. Determination, as well as inspection and evaluation of brittleness, porosity, vein nitrides and microstructure before nitriding.

3 Terms and Definitions

The terms and definitions defined in GB/T 7232 and the following apply to this document. 3.1 The vertical distance from the surface of the nitrided layer to the point where the hardness is 50HV higher than the core. Note. The core hardness is the arithmetic mean of 5 or more measured values at 3 times the depth of the hardened layer, rounded off to an integer multiple of 10HV. 3.2 The thickness of the surface compound layer formed by the infiltrating elements and the metal elements in the matrix during chemical heat treatment. 3.3 Microstructure of steel before nitriding treatment. 3.4 The degree of chipping of the corners of the Vickers hardness indentation on the surface of the nitrided part under a certain test force. 3.5 The density of micropores in the compound layer on the surface of nitrided parts.
